Husband of missing NSW teacher jailed over firearms stash

September 14, 2015 - 4:42PM

The husband of a teacher who vanished without a trace on the NSW North Coast six months ago has been jailed for firearms offences after police uncovered his gun stash in bushland.
Less than a month after reporting his wife Sharon missing, John Wallace Edwards walked into his local police station in April to report to police he had hidden firearms around Grafton.
The 60-year-old helped police locate the weapons, in bushland and near waterways, and was charged with unregistered firearm and ammunition possession.
He is now serving a minimum of three months behind bars as the search for his wife goes on without him.

Edwards’ gun offences not linked to Sharon's disappearance

Tim Howard | 16th Sep 2015 10:00 AM

THE jailing of the husband of missing Coutts Crossing school teacher Sharon Edwards on firearms offences has nothing to do with her disappearance, says police.
Coffs Clarence crime manager detective inspector Darren Jameson noted there had been some "hysteria" on social media drawing a link between the two, but this was wrong.
"There has never been any linkage whatsoever between the disappearance of Mrs Edwards and these offences," Det Insp Jameson said.
John Edwards, the estranged husband of Mrs Edwards was jailed for firearms offences in Grafton Local Court on Friday.
